ANI

The uppercase automon tools need to know


Photo for Author | Kanele

Python has one of the most popular languages, due to its simple syntax and strong skills. While many people know the Python web development, machine-study, and data science, and is through automated matters. From Website Testing and Testing Applications Pressure, to move the desktop flows and Python assessment projects itself, Automon's Automation Tools existed everywhere in today's engineer's toolkit.

In this article, we will examine the top 5 tools that will know every engineer. These tools are widely used throughout the industry and can help you change jobs in almost all Python project.

1.

Selenium is a leading tool for default web browsers with Python. Allows you to imitate user interaction, such as clicks, filling forms, and navigation pages, in all major browsers. Companies use to perform effective examination, assessment examination, and ongoing monitoring of web applications. Its flexibility, scale support, and strong public support makes it a valuable tool for the development of the web and quality.

Read more:

2. Location: Rating load test has facilitated

Locust is an open tool for the app and loading of web applications. You can easily write user moral contexts and imitate thousands or even millions of users Pressure-Pressure Pressure-Pressure-Pressure-Pressure Pressure.

I use the locusts to test my machine study equipment. It is easy to set and running, and it has helped me to build fast, powerful api. The locusts also allow me to imitate the malicious immorality, which makes it useful in assessing and improving safety.

Read more:

3. Pyauutogui: Desktop Gui Automation

Pyauutogui is your Gablee Gablury for the automatic functions of your desktop. It allows you to control the mouse and keyboard, take screenshots, and change repeated tasks in all windows, macos, and linux. Even if you need to use data entry, check the desktop apps, or create travel work, Pyutogui makes Desktop Automation accessible and powerful.

Read more:

4. Playwright: Modern-ending browser replacement of the end

Playwright, developed by Microsoft, is a default cutting tool that supports Chromium, Firefox, and Webkit browsers. With the new MCP (Model Grotector Protocol Server, you can connect the PlayWreight to Desktop applications as a Claude Desktop or cursor, enabling agents or browser control documents using organized commands.

You can also write the final final exams in Python or JavaScript, which have features such as the default, the compatible manufacture, and true support of the browser.

Read more:

5. Pytest: A convertible test frame

The Pytest is a powerful and avacated testing of the Python. It simves simplifying and evaluating cases, supporting the adjustment of setting and breaking free, and boasts the rich plugin plugin. Pytest is ready for a unit, working, and the consolidation test, whether you test the Agents AI, web apps, resting apis, or the movement of the study machine. I use the pytest almost all the project to hold bedbugs early and make sure my docker photos build and post well, for a little suffering.

Read more:

Store

These five automated pythonic tools are important to anyone looking for the processing and changing repetitions in 2025. Whether you work in the web, desktop, or a test testing, these tools will help you take your Automation skills straight to the next level. Just describe your user's behavior in the text, and allow these tools to treat rest, making your performance movement early, very dependable, and ready to ship.

Abid Awa (@ 1abidaswan) is a certified scientist for a scientist who likes the machine reading models. Currently, focus on the creation of the content and writing technical blogs in a machine learning and data scientific technology. Avid holds a Master degree in technical management and Bachelor degree in Telecommunication Engineering. His viewpoint builds AI product uses a Graph Neural network for students who strive to be ill.

Source link

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button